Ever since I went fully automated I have been nervous about a controller breakdown. After ten years nothing on my Aquatronica died except the normal items like pH and ORP probes. Then 5 years ago I got there latest model controller and thankfully it was a drop in replacement. Last year I finally bought a complete spare kit. Now I have spares of everything on my tank.
For new aquarium owners the first spare you should have is a return pump and some plumbing supplies. After that I suggest buying what you can afford as the years go by. You will never appreciate a spare item until the day you really need it..
